Measures matter: assessing childhood maltreatment and emotion dysregulation in a transdiagnostic sample

Katja I. Seitz, Inga Schalinski, Babette Renneberg, Nina Heinrichs, Antonia Brühl, Sylvia Steinmann, Corinne Neukel, Sabine C. Herpertz

<b>Background:</b> Childhood maltreatment (CM) is a major risk factor for different mental disorders and transdiagnostic mechanisms, including emotion dysregulation. Progress in the field has been constrained by substantial variability in the measurement of CM across studies. <b>Objective:</b> We aimed to examine the associations among three common retrospective measures of CM and their relationship with emotion dysregulation in a transdiagnostic adult sample, with a focus on exploring the significance of sensitive developmental periods. <b>Method:</b> In our cross-sectional study, we collected data from <i>N</i> = 462 participants with and without different mental disorders. We assessed facets of CM using two questionnaires and one in-person interview, specifically the Childhood Trauma Questionnaire – Short Form (CTQ-SF), the Childhood Experience of Care and Abuse Questionnaire (CECA.Q), and the brief German interview version of the Maltreatment and Abuse Chronology of Exposure scale (MACE), the KERF-40+. We measured emotion dysregulation in a subsample of <i>n</i> = 244 participants using the Difficulties in Emotion Regulation Scale (DERS). We analysed data applying correlational analyses and machine-learning-based conditional random forest regression. <b>Results:</b> In our transdiagnostic sample, global scores (including sum, multiplicity, and duration scores) and subscale scores of the CTQ-SF, CECA.Q, and KERF-40+ were highly intercorrelated. Both global scores of the CTQ-SF and KERF-40+, and emotional CM scores of the CTQ-SF, CECA.Q, and KERF-40+ showed significant associations with the DERS total score. Regarding sensitive developmental periods, exposure to parental emotional abuse, emotional neglect, and emotional and physical abuse by peers – particularly during the ages 12–17 – was significantly associated with the DERS total score. <b>Conclusions:</b> Despite substantial differences in the facets of CM assessed, the CTQ-SF, CECA.Q, and KERF-40+ demonstrate high convergent validity. While CTQ-SF and CECA.Q allow for a more efficient assessment of CM experiences, the KERF-40+ offers added value for developmentally sensitive analyses of adult emotion dysregulation.
